Kansas hosted its State Freestyle and Greco tournament in Topeka, Saturday, May 3 and Sunday, May 4. Liberal Wrestling Club made the trip and took 4 wrestlers to compete in the event. AC Gomez, Elias Holcomb, Marco Jimenez and Emanuel Zetino all competed.
The day began with Greco competition where all four competed. Holcomb, Jimenez and Zetino represented the team well but did not place. “I am glad they took on the challenge and put themselves out there to try for the state title,” Coach Krista Holcomb said.
Gomez started the day with complete concentration and his eye on the prize and it paid off when he won the first place match.
“AC has amazing upper body strength and Greco is definitely his strength. He has worked hard for this moment and I am so incredibly proud of all that he has accomplished. This was his day! He deserves that Gold!” Holcomb said.
Gomez, Jimenez and Zetino all competed in Freestyle at the conclusion of Greco. Gomez finished 3rd for Freestyle. With the placing for both styles, he has earned a chance to compete on the Kansas 16U National Duals team in Utah in June. He also secured a spot to compete at Fargo in June. “AC’s goal going into this was to make Fargo. He accomplished that and more this weekend! His goals don’t end here though. He is more on fire and ready to accomplish big things in the months and years to come!” Holcomb said.
